1 GENERAL DESCRIPTION Tron SART20 is emergency equipment consisting of: 1. Tron SART20 radar transponder. 2. Mounting rope for life rafts / life boats. The 9 GHz radar transponder type Tron SART20 is developed by Jotron AS to meet the rules and regulations for use on vessels and life rafts in the maritime service. Tron SART20 meets the specifications for 9 GHz radar transponders for use in search and rescue operations at sea.
Maximum distance to a ship will normally be about 10 nm and approximately 30nm to a helicopter, dependent on the helicopters altitude. The transponder will not give any alarms further away than this. The primary alarm will usually be an Emergency Position Indicating Radio Beacon (EPIRB) or distress call on VHF / HF - manual or via digital selcall. The Tron SART20 should be activated immediately after activation of the EPIRB or by instruction from the rescue control centre.
Indicators: Tron SART20 is equipped with an LED and a built in buzzer to indicate operation. The LED will normally flash with a frequency of 1 per second to show that the Tron SART20 is activated. When a search and rescue unit is approaching the internal speaker will sound each time the SART20 is hit by the radar. A continuous sound from the buzzer means that the ship or helicopter is close to the Tron SART20 and the radar is hitting the Tron SART20 continuously. Battery unit.
2 TECHNICAL SPECIFICATIONS 2.1 ELECTRICAL SPECIFICATIONS Frequency: X-band (3 cm) (9.2 - 9.5 GHz) Temperature range: Operating: -20 to +55°C Storage: -30 to +65°C Radiated power: > 400 mW e.i.r.p (+26 dBm) Sweep type: 12 sweep sawtooth type Forward 7.5 us ±1 ms Return 0.4 us ±0.1 ms Starts with return sweep. Receive sensitivity: Better than -50 dBm e.r.s. Response delay: Max 0.5 ms Antenna pattern: Horizontal polarization. Omni directional radiation in the horizontal plane. Greater than ±12.
2.2 MECHANICAL SPECIFICATION Materials used: Transponder housing: Polycarbonate with 10% fibreglass. Bracket: Anodized aluminum.

4 INSTALLATION Tron SART20 can be mounted several ways, depending on the options available. As a general rule, the transponder should be mounted as high as possible to increase line of sight to the search and rescue units. Metal objects close to the transponder should be avoided, these will limit the performance in the directions they are located. 4.1 BRACKETS There are three different mounting brackets available. 1. A telescopic pole can be used to extend the height of the Tron SART20, inside or outside the life raft/boat. Simply extend the attached pole to the full length (app. 1,2m from the top of the Tron SART20). Make sure that the rod is locked by pulling hard when it is fully extended. The rod can now be fastened or held by a person.
4.3 Using the 10m rope The 10m. rope is meant to hang the Tron SART20 inside a life raft. Any objects that the rope can be attached to can be used. As long as the transponder is kept away from any metal objects, the performance will not be notable degraded because of the canvas of the life raft. 5.3 TEST OF TRON SART20 Test of the Tron SART20 is done using the ships own 3 cm radar. The radar display will show different patterns depending on the range to the transponder. See Figure 5.3a, b and c for details of the radar display. Note that the examples shown are typical and will vary with the radar performance (height, power output and sensitivity). With the transponder located close to the radar the signals will appear as rings on the radar display.
